Description | 4-Allylcatechol (Hydroxychavicol) has antioxidant activity, it has protective activity against the photosensitization-induced damage to lipids and proteins of rat liver mitochondria, which attributes to its free radical and singlet oxygen scavenging properties. |
Source |
Synonyms | 4-Allylpyrocatechol, Hydroxychavicol |
Molecular Weight | 150.17 |
Formula | C9H10O2 |
CAS No. | 1126-61-0 |
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year
DMSO: 100 mg/mL (665.91 mM)
